A skilled DJ needs to gauge the crowd in front of him and understand what genre of music will be popular with them. Additionally, he must be aware of the audience’s mood and understand the proper musical sequencing in order to progressively improve everyone’s mood until they are all dancing and having a good time.

The size of the crowd shouldn’t make a great DJ scared or apprehensive; in fact, the cheers of approval from the crowd should inspire him to work harder and keep choosing songs, noises, and effects to ensure that everyone has the best time possible.

One must be aware that a DJ’s duties go beyond just playing loud music at parties if they want to be mentioned among Nigeria’s greatest DJs.



1. DJ Exclusive

Rotimi Alakija, better known as Dj Xclusive, is currently the best DJ in the nation. DJ Exclusive is the most well-known DJ in the nation and a well-known celebrity disc jockey with a reported net worth of $6 million.

DJ Exclusive was born in the UK, although he completed his secondary education in Nigeria before coming back to the UK to enroll in Reading University’s Physics and Computer Science program.

He began his career in 2003 by working at a number of nightclubs, including Funky Buddha, Aura Mayfair, Penthouse, and Jalouse. The best DJ prize was given to DJ Exclusive at the 2010 Nigeria Entertainment Awards, which were hosted in the United States.


2. DJ Jimmy Jatt

Jimmy Amu, better known as DJ Jimmy Jatt, has long been one of the top DJs in Nigeria. In fact, he is still the most well-known among both the young and the old.

In Nigeria, DJ Jimmy Jatt is a major force in the entertainment industry. His mere presence at an event is enough to draw large crowds as well as top performers who want to work with him and will treat the event seriously if he is a featured performer.

DJ Jimmy Jatt is an experienced professional who helped establish hip-hop music in Nigeria. In actuality, he began as a rapper but switched to DJing when he was unable to find a platform to begin his music career.


3. DJ Kaywise

DJ Kaywise was born in Lagos, Nigeria. He hails from Ile Ife in the Osun state. He went to elementary and secondary school in Lagos State, his home state. After releasing the mixtape “Emergency,” which included a selection of well-known songs from the time, his net worth is thought to be over $740,000.

He has achieved a lot as a DJ, which has boosted his name and allowed him to establish himself. The DJ runs a DJ Academy across the nation (the first to be established by a DJ in Nigeria).


4. DJ Kentalky

DJ Kentalky, also known as Ifeoluwa Ibrahim Ozimah, is a rising DJ. DJ Kentalky is the resident DJ at Naija FM.

His professional journey began in 2001 when he took the MTV Guinness Extra Smooth Train to Abuja and Benin. He has also worked with worldwide DJ Mannie thanks to his remarkable abilities.


5. DJ SPINALL 

Sodamola Oluseye Desmond, better known as DJ Spinall, is a multi-award-winning DJ from Nigeria. No matter what kind of attire he chooses, he is renowned for his distinctive traditional cap outfit. He signed with Atlantic Records in the UK, and it’s estimated that he has a net worth of about $850,000.


He studied at a number of DJ schools and under the tutelage of veterans like DJ Jimmy Jatt, DJ Slim, and DJ Hotega. He holds a bachelor’s degree in electrical and electronic engineering.


6. DJ Neptune

DJ Neptune real name is Patrick Imohiosen. DJ Neptune was born and raised in Lagos even though he is from the Edo State. Prior to being a freelance DJ and appearing at both local and international events, DJ Neptune began his career as a radio DJ on Ray Power FM.


At the 2008 “NEA” Nigeria Entertainment Awards in New York, America, DJ Neptune was nominated for a number of awards, including Best World DJ. At the Nigeria Entertainment Awards in 2009 in Washington, D.C., he was crowned Best World DJ. In 2010, he won the Tush Award for Best DJ in Nigeria. Additionally, he received the International Best DJ award at the first “AEA” Africa Entertainment Award in Malaysia.


7.  DJ Cuppy

Nigerian entertainer, producer, and musician Femi Otedola has revolutionized the country’s entertainment industry. Femi Otedola, a well-known entrepreneur and businessman, is the father of Florence Ifeoluwa Otedola, better known as DJ Cuppy.

She has a net worth of over $2.5 million and is currently employed as a DJ by Red Velvet Music Group, making her one of the most successful female DJs in the nation.

9. DJ Sose

Thomas Amar-Aigbe, aka DJ Sose, is a Nigerian/Hungarian DJ most recognized for his sharp haircut and large facial tattoo. He was created in Oyo state. He is worth $400,000 overall. He is 39 years old and has a $400k net worth.
He has been a DJ since 2010, and his jazz, rock, hip-hop, afrobeat, and classical music has caused many people to dance. His own record label, Gray Tiger Entertainment, has been nominated for Nigeria’s best DJ award. 


10.MasterKraft

Nigerian DJ Masterkraft is well-known and has worked with a variety of artists. One of Nigeria’s top ten music producers, his mixtape has been played on a variety of musical programs. The actual name of Masterkraft is Sunday Ginikachukwu Nweke. In addition to being a Nigerian record producer, he is also a DJ, pianist, and poet.
